Let’s start with the Revlon Colorstay Full Time Mascara (R259.95) SHOP

I’ve been wearing this mascara non-stop for a few weeks now, and it’s genuinely one of the best I’ve tried in a long time. What sets it apart? The formula is engineered with Double Shield Technology, which sounds fancy—and honestly, it is. It stands up to sweat, oil, and even the odd teary moment (no judgment here), and somehow still looks as fresh at 9 p.m. as it did at 9 a.m.

The texture is light and buildable, thanks to the Sunflower Microfibers, which means I can add volume without clumps or that dreaded heavy feeling. I love that I can go for a soft, natural lash during the day and then layer it up for something more dramatic at night. The brush is also worth mentioning—it’s a Universal Brush, designed to suit all eye shapes, and it really does catch every lash, from the inner corner to those stubborn little guys on the outer edge.

It’s available in both waterproof and non-waterproof versions, plus a gorgeous natural brown that’s perfect for those those with very blonde hair and pale lashes.

But the real surprise for me was the Colorstay Lash Serum + Liner (R229.95) SHOP

I expected a decent liquid liner, sure—but I didn’t expect one that also nourishes my lashes. This hybrid liner-serum is infused with Tahitian Microalgae (yes, it sounds luxurious because it is), and in just a week I noticed my lashes looking fuller and healthier, even bare.

Application is a dream—the precision brush tip glides on like silk, no tugging or skipping, and the pigment is bold, inky black with just one swipe. It dries down quickly and then stays. No smudging. No flaking. And yes, it’s waterproof, too. It’s become a staple in my everyday routine, especially on days when I want to keep my look simple but polished.
